질소산화물 저감을 위한 SCR TYPE CEM의 설계평가
정석윤(Seokyoon Jeong),정홍석(Hongseok Jung),이근우(Kunwoo Yi),조연근(Yonguen Cho),김경훈(Kyunghun Kim),김혜삼(Hyesam Kim) 한국자동차공학회 2006 한국자동차공학회 춘 추계 학술대회 논문집 Vol.- No.-
SCR system for diesel engine vehicles is a device to reduce NOx from the emission gas of the diesel engine causing selective catalytic reaction by utilizing a metal catalyst with ammonia, NH₃, or HC as a reductant, and the device is recognized as a unique technology to meet future emission regulation for NOx such as Euro-V (2008). Under the current circumstance that the development for diverse post process technologies is in process, in this study, we evaluated the pressure and uniformity inside of SCR TYPE CEM(Catalyst Exhaust Muffler) reducing NOx among noxious gasses, through design and CFD(Computational Fluid Dynamics) analysis.
